An educational organization in Scotland is seeking Seasonal Assistant Rangers for a unique position focused on visitor engagement and nature conservation. This role requires patrolling and operational delivery in Holyrood Park, ensuring visitor safety while sharing the rich historical narratives of Scotland.

Ideal candidates will enjoy outdoor work and have an interest in engaging with the public. Flexible hours include weekends and late shifts as part of a rota. This post offers an opportunity to gain experience in the tourism industry.
